Toyguide Update: CW50 Barriss Offee

The Yakface Toyguide updates resume today with the addition of Barriss Offee from The Clone Wars Collection

PROS: Fantastic esthetically and the likeness is near perfect for the animated character. The fabric for the skirt is some of the best I’ve see in the modern era of collecting.

CONS: This will be a sticking point for some – articulation. There are no knee or ankle joints and the elbow only feature simple swivel joints.

CW49: Riot Control Clone Trooper

The Yakface Toyguide updates resume today with the addition of the Riot Control Clone Trooper from The Clone Wars Collection

PROS: Clone uses the original super-articulated trooper body. Great accessories and deco. Baton attaches to shield for easy storage.

CONS: You’ll want a few but finding them in quantities at retail, at least initially might take a bit of work.

VC34 Jango Fett

The Yakface Toyguide updates resume today with the addition of Jango Fett from the Vintage Collection’s Attack of the Clones wave (Wave 4).

PROS: Pretty much the definitive Jango in terms of sculpt and accessories. Re-worked, scene specific gauntlets are a nice touch as is the new jetpack and missile.

CONS: The gauntlet blades are not removable (i.e. they are deployed all the time). Overall color of the jumpsuit seems to still be “off” a bit but it’s a vast improvement over the grape flavored version included in the recent Geonosis Arena set.
